Hello. Recently, when I bought an album and a few other songs, I noticed that I have doubles of songs in my iPhone's music library when under the album's list of songs. However, I am not able to play these copies for some reason. And they have a stop button next to them. I don think they take up space but in know they don't do anything so I'd certainly like them gone. Then that happens but instead of a stop button it is a speaker next to the name. Neither of which do anything if I click the button or the song. The normal song plays so I am not without the album, but I am with a name that goes along with the song that does nothing... Please lemme know if there is a way to get rid of these. Thanks for any advice! [:
I had the same problem (with the stop button showing up next to a song). The following steps worked to get rid of the stop button:
-On the iPhone, go into Store, Purchased, and locate the songs/albums affected;
-Redownload the songs/albums.
As for any duplicates, I had to manually delete them from the iPhone.
